The Koa Concert Jumbo Cutaway model is approximately the same size as a Taylor Grand Auditorium and has been one of Goodall's most popular models for several years. It essentially defined the fingerstyle steel-string guitar, and in terms of balance, clarity, and overall volume the KCJC was hard to beat regardless of price. James chose some particularly nice figured koa of the back and sides on this beauty. This example has been played but has only very light fret wear and shows few signs of handling, which means it's had excellent care. No cracks, no signs of repair, and no changes. Made in Kailua-Kona Hawaii by James Goodall and a small crew of like-minded luthiers who were an excellent compromise between the big guitar factory production and individual builders.
